BTS
It’s no surprise that we mention BTS first, they have been a catalyst in bringing the unique sound that K-Pop is known for worldwide. This seven-member South Korean band got their start in 2013 with their debut album “2 Cool 4 Skool”. They found moderate success with that album, but it wasn’t until 2016 that they became known how the world sees them today. In 2016 they had two songs that really put them on the map, “Wings” and later, “DNA” which had a music video that broke records. If you are new to BTS and looking for song recommendations, I would say start with “DNA” and then make your way to their other hits such as “Blood Sweat & Tears” and a recent song called “Dynamite”.
They have a diverse sound that includes a mix of EDM and hip-hop, but they do have more soulful songs that are slower and just as enjoyable. BTS is the first K-Pop group to be featured on an American music award show. They currently have over 20 million followers on Twitter and to top that, they have over 30 million subscribers on Youtube. BTS has played a major role in getting the sounds of K-Pop the international attention it deserves.

BIBI
BIBI is a solo singer, songwriter, rapper, and producer that has also gained some traction within the last two years. Her first appearance in 2019 with her song “Binu” has gained 3.5 million views on Youtube. BIBI does have a different sound than traditional K-Pop music, her sound has a more R&B flow, nonetheless an artist to put on your radar. Right now, she doesn’t have any signs of a new song release but given the popularity she has gained that is sure to change.
EXO
This nine-member boy band got their start with an album named “XOXO” released in 2013 with two versions, one in South Korea, and the other in Mandarin. In the early years of EXO’s career they had additional members who ended up leaving, which is how we got the nine members here today. Fast forward to 2015 the band then released their album, “Exodus”, that spent weeks on multiple music charts and won them Album of the Year at the 2015 Mnet Asian Music Awards.
EXO also featured at the ceremony of the 2018 Winter Olympics. Since then, they have gained recognition not only in their countries but also in the United States and Canada. They continue to streamline right alongside BTS in terms of popularity. The latest word on this group is they have the potential to make another comeback since their last album release in 2019. There’s also been word that some of the members are focusing on solo projects in 2020, but we hope to see the group come together to produce another record-breaking album.
Se So Neon
K-Pop isn’t all about the upbeat and catchy tunes that has brought it center stage- until recently, South Korean indie rock bands have taken the backseat. This isn’t the case for Se So Neon, the three-member band that has rebelled against the status quo to produce their music. They gained attention back in 2017 with their single “A Long Dream”. Later that year, they released their first album “Summer Plumage”, which launched them into the spotlight. Their album went on to win both Best Rock Song and Rookie of the Year at the 2018 Korean Music Awards.
Se So Neon released their second album earlier this year called “Maladaptive”. Their new album is exciting and showcases the bands natural talent.

Itzy
Itzy is a powerful group of feminine queens that promote the image of self-love and confidence. They had a roaring start when just nine days after their debut of “Dalla Dalla”they earned their first music video win. Itzy is the first girl group to achieve this so quickly in the industry! Over the past year they have gained popularity for showcasing their talent- even landing them a number 2 spot on the Billboard World Digital Song Sales Chart.
Itzy also was awarded at the 2020 Korean Music Awards, earning two nominations – Rookie of the Year and Best Pop Song of the Year. They are an empowering group of women that are sure to rock the music world with their distinctive flair.
Red Velvet
This South Korean girl group got their start in 2014 with their single “Happiness”. Their sound includes a mix of electronic, funk, and hip hop while also having a hint of R&B. Red Velvet is a group of five women who give you the best of all worlds. Each member brings forward their own unique style- you can describe these girls as bold, sweet, and sparkly. They have shaken up charts with their unexpected new concepts and sounds, and even English version of their hits!
